Irwin and Colton are seeking an experienced Safety, Health & Environment Manager to join the Leadership Team of a major industrial organisation at its South Wales site. This is a senior leadership role responsible for providing strategic direction across safety, health, environment, process safety and security, ensuring the site operates safely, sustainably and in compliance with all regulatory requirements.
Key Responsibilities:
Provide strategic leadership across Safety, Health, Environment and Security, acting as the site's lead authority and trusted advisor to senior leaders and operational teams.
Own and continuously improve the site's SHE management systems, ensuring alignment with ISO 45001, ISO 14001 and corporate standards, while supporting compliance with COMAH requirements.
Develop and deliver the site's SHE strategy, driving continuous improvement in safety culture, governance, environmental performance and major hazard risk management.
Build strong relationships with regulators, emergency services and external stakeholders, while leading emergency preparedness, resilience and crisis management activities.
Lead and develop a high-performing SHE and Security team, while supporting capital projects, operational improvements and organisational change through effective risk management.Ideal Candidate:
Experienced SHE leader with a background in a major hazard industry such as chemicals, metals, mining/extraction, energy, pharmaceuticals, oil and gas, or another COMAH-regulated environment.
Degree qualified in a science, engineering, environmental or related discipline, with a NEBOSH Diploma or equivalent higher-level SHE qualification and relevant environmental qualification.
Demonstrable experience operating within a COMAH-regulated or major hazard environment, with a strong understanding of process safety and major hazard risk management.
Proven leadership experience, including managing and developing teams, influencing at a strategic level and engaging effectively with regulators and external stakeholders.This is an excellent opportunity to join a major industrial organisation in a senior SHE leadership position, where you will play a key role in managing major hazard risks, influencing strategic decision-making and supporting the long-term success of the site.
